/***************************************************************
WindowQuad
***************************************************************/
WindowQuad WindowQuad::makeSubQuad(double x1, double y1, double x2, double y2) const
{
assert(x1 < x2 && y1 < y2 && x1 >= left() && x2 <= right() && y1 >= top() && y2 <= bottom());
#ifndef NDEBUG
if (isTransformed())
kFatal(1212) << "Splitting quads is allowed only in pre-paint calls!" ;
#endif
WindowQuad ret(*this);
// vertices are clockwise starting from topleft
ret.verts[ 0 ].px = x1;
ret.verts[ 3 ].px = x1;
ret.verts[ 1 ].px = x2;
ret.verts[ 2 ].px = x2;
ret.verts[ 0 ].py = y1;
ret.verts[ 1 ].py = y1;
ret.verts[ 2 ].py = y2;
ret.verts[ 3 ].py = y2;
// original x/y are supposed to be the same, no transforming is done here
ret.verts[ 0 ].ox = x1;
ret.verts[ 3 ].ox = x1;
ret.verts[ 1 ].ox = x2;
ret.verts[ 2 ].ox = x2;
ret.verts[ 0 ].oy = y1;
ret.verts[ 1 ].oy = y1;
ret.verts[ 2 ].oy = y2;
ret.verts[ 3 ].oy = y2;
double my_tleft = verts[ 0 ].tx;
double my_tright = verts[ 2 ].tx;
double my_ttop = verts[ 0 ].ty;
double my_tbottom = verts[ 2 ].ty;
double tleft = (x1 - left()) / (right() - left()) * (my_tright - my_tleft) + my_tleft;
double tright = (x2 - left()) / (right() - left()) * (my_tright - my_tleft) + my_tleft;
double ttop = (y1 - top()) / (bottom() - top()) * (my_tbottom - my_ttop) + my_ttop;
double tbottom = (y2 - top()) / (bottom() - top()) * (my_tbottom - my_ttop) + my_ttop;
ret.verts[ 0 ].tx = tleft;
ret.verts[ 3 ].tx = tleft;
ret.verts[ 1 ].tx = tright;
ret.verts[ 2 ].tx = tright;
ret.verts[ 0 ].ty = ttop;
ret.verts[ 1 ].ty = ttop;
ret.verts[ 2 ].ty = tbottom;
ret.verts[ 3 ].ty = tbottom;
return ret;
}
bool WindowQuad::smoothNeeded() const
{
// smoothing is needed if the width or height of the quad does not match the original size
double width = verts[ 1 ].ox - verts[ 0 ].ox;
double height = verts[ 2 ].oy - verts[ 1 ].oy;
return(verts[ 1 ].px - verts[ 0 ].px != width || verts[ 2 ].px - verts[ 3 ].px != width
|| verts[ 2 ].py - verts[ 1 ].py != height || verts[ 3 ].py - verts[ 0 ].py != height);
}
/***************************************************************
WindowQuadList
***************************************************************/
WindowQuadList WindowQuadList::splitAtX(double x) const
{
WindowQuadList ret;
foreach (const WindowQuad & quad, *this) {
#ifndef NDEBUG
if (quad.isTransformed())
kFatal(1212) << "Splitting quads is allowed only in pre-paint calls!" ;
#endif
bool wholeleft = true;
bool wholeright = true;
for (int i = 0;
i < 4;
++i) {
if (quad[ i ].x() < x)
wholeright = false;
if (quad[ i ].x() > x)
wholeleft = false;
}
if (wholeleft || wholeright) { // is whole in one split part
ret.append(quad);
continue;
}
if (quad.left() == quad.right()) { // quad has no size
ret.append(quad);
continue;
}
ret.append(quad.makeSubQuad(quad.left(), quad.top(), x, quad.bottom()));
ret.append(quad.makeSubQuad(x, quad.top(), quad.right(), quad.bottom()));
}
return ret;
}
WindowQuadList WindowQuadList::splitAtY(double y) const
{
WindowQuadList ret;
foreach (const WindowQuad & quad, *this) {
#ifndef NDEBUG
if (quad.isTransformed())
kFatal(1212) << "Splitting quads is allowed only in pre-paint calls!" ;
#endif
bool wholetop = true;
bool wholebottom = true;
for (int i = 0;
i < 4;
++i) {
if (quad[ i ].y() < y)
wholebottom = false;
if (quad[ i ].y() > y)
wholetop = false;
}
if (wholetop || wholebottom) { // is whole in one split part
ret.append(quad);
continue;
}
if (quad.top() == quad.bottom()) { // quad has no size
ret.append(quad);
continue;
}
ret.append(quad.makeSubQuad(quad.left(), quad.top(), quad.right(), y));
ret.append(quad.makeSubQuad(quad.left(), y, quad.right(), quad.bottom()));
}
return ret;
}
WindowQuadList WindowQuadList::makeGrid(int maxquadsize) const
{
if (empty())
return *this;
// find the bounding rectangle
double left = first().left();
double right = first().right();
double top = first().top();
double bottom = first().bottom();
foreach (const WindowQuad & quad, *this) {
#ifndef NDEBUG
if (quad.isTransformed())
kFatal(1212) << "Splitting quads is allowed only in pre-paint calls!" ;
#endif
left = qMin(left, quad.left());
right = qMax(right, quad.right());
top = qMin(top, quad.top());
bottom = qMax(bottom, quad.bottom());
}
WindowQuadList ret;
for (double x = left;
x < right;
x += maxquadsize) {
for (double y = top;
y < bottom;
y += maxquadsize) {
foreach (const WindowQuad & quad, *this) {
if (QRectF(QPointF(quad.left(), quad.top()), QPointF(quad.right(), quad.bottom()))
.intersects(QRectF(x, y, maxquadsize, maxquadsize))) {
ret.append(quad.makeSubQuad(qMax(x, quad.left()), qMax(y, quad.top()),
qMin(quad.right(), x + maxquadsize), qMin(quad.bottom(), y + maxquadsize)));
}
}
}
}
return ret;
}

/***************************************************************
PaintClipper
***************************************************************/
QStack< QRegion >* PaintClipper::areas = NULL;
PaintClipper::PaintClipper(const QRegion& allowed_area)
: area(allowed_area)
{
push(area);
}
PaintClipper::~PaintClipper()
{
pop(area);
}
void PaintClipper::push(const QRegion& allowed_area)
{
if (allowed_area == infiniteRegion()) // don't push these
return;
if (areas == NULL)
areas = new QStack< QRegion >;
areas->push(allowed_area);
}
void PaintClipper::pop(const QRegion& allowed_area)
{
if (allowed_area == infiniteRegion())
return;
Q_ASSERT(areas != NULL);
Q_ASSERT(areas->top() == allowed_area);
areas->pop();
if (areas->isEmpty()) {
delete areas;
areas = NULL;
}
}
bool PaintClipper::clip()
{
return areas != NULL;
}
QRegion PaintClipper::paintArea()
{
assert(areas != NULL); // can be called only with clip() == true
QRegion ret = QRegion(0, 0, displayWidth(), displayHeight());
foreach (const QRegion & r, *areas)
ret &= r;
return ret;
}
struct PaintClipper::Iterator::Data {
Data() : index(0) {}
int index;
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
QVector< QRect > rects;
#endif
};
PaintClipper::Iterator::Iterator()
: data(new Data)
{
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
if (clip() && effects->compositingType() == OpenGLCompositing) {
#ifndef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GLES
glPushAttrib(GL_SCISSOR_BIT);
#endif
if (!effects->isRenderTargetBound())
glEnable(GL_SCISSOR_TEST);
data->rects = paintArea().rects();
data->index = -1;
next(); // move to the first one
}
#endif
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_XRENDER_COMPOSITING
if (clip() && effects->compositingType() == XRenderCompositing) {
XserverRegion region = toXserverRegion(paintArea());
XFixesSetPictureClipRegion(display(), effects->xrenderBufferPicture(), 0, 0, region);
XFixesDestroyRegion(display(), region); // it's ref-counted
}
#endif
}
PaintClipper::Iterator::~Iterator()
{
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
if (clip() && effects->compositingType() == OpenGLCompositing) {
if (!effects->isRenderTargetBound())
glDisable(GL_SCISSOR_TEST);
#ifndef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GLES
glPopAttrib();
#endif
}
#endif
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_XRENDER_COMPOSITING
if (clip() && effects->compositingType() == XRenderCompositing)
XFixesSetPictureClipRegion(display(), effects->xrenderBufferPicture(), 0, 0, None);
#endif
delete data;
}
bool PaintClipper::Iterator::isDone()
{
if (!clip())
return data->index == 1; // run once
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
if (effects->compositingType() == OpenGLCompositing)
return data->index >= data->rects.count(); // run once per each area
#endif
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_XRENDER_COMPOSITING
if (effects->compositingType() == XRenderCompositing)
return data->index == 1; // run once
#endif
abort();
}
void PaintClipper::Iterator::next()
{
data->index++;
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
if (clip() && effects->compositingType() == OpenGLCompositing && !effects->isRenderTargetBound() && data->index < data->rects.count()) {
const QRect& r = data->rects[ data->index ];
// Scissor rect has to be given in OpenGL coords
glScissor(r.x(), displayHeight() - r.y() - r.height(), r.width(), r.height());
}
#endif
}
QRect PaintClipper::Iterator::boundingRect() const
{
if (!clip())
return infiniteRegion();
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_OPENGL_COMPOSITING
if (effects->compositingType() == OpenGLCompositing)
return data->rects[ data->index ];
#endif
#ifdef KWIN_HAVE_XRENDER_COMPOSITING
if (effects->compositingType() == XRenderCompositing)
return paintArea().boundingRect();
#endif
abort();
return infiniteRegion();
}

/***************************************************************
WindowMotionManager
***************************************************************/
WindowMotionManager::WindowMotionManager(bool useGlobalAnimationModifier)
: m_useGlobalAnimationModifier(useGlobalAnimationModifier)
{
// TODO: Allow developer to modify motion attributes
} // TODO: What happens when the window moves by an external force?
WindowMotionManager::~WindowMotionManager()
{
}
void WindowMotionManager::manage(EffectWindow *w)
{
if (m_managedWindows.contains(w))
return;
double strength = 0.08;
double smoothness = 4.0;
if (m_useGlobalAnimationModifier && effects->animationTimeFactor()) {
// If the factor is == 0 then we just skip the calculation completely
strength = 0.08 / effects->animationTimeFactor();
smoothness = effects->animationTimeFactor() * 4.0;
}
m_managedWindows[ w ] = WindowMotion();
m_managedWindows[ w ].translation.setStrength(strength);
m_managedWindows[ w ].translation.setSmoothness(smoothness);
m_managedWindows[ w ].scale.setStrength(strength * 1.33);
m_managedWindows[ w ].scale.setSmoothness(smoothness / 2.0);
m_managedWindows[ w ].translation.setValue(w->pos());
m_managedWindows[ w ].scale.setValue(QPointF(1.0, 1.0));
}
void WindowMotionManager::unmanage(EffectWindow *w)
{
if (!m_managedWindows.contains(w))
return;
QPointF diffT = m_managedWindows[ w ].translation.distance();
QPointF diffS = m_managedWindows[ w ].scale.distance();
m_movingWindowsSet.remove(w);
m_managedWindows.remove(w);
}
void WindowMotionManager::unmanageAll()
{
m_managedWindows.clear();
m_movingWindowsSet.clear();
}
void WindowMotionManager::calculate(int time)
{
if (!effects->animationTimeFactor()) {
// Just skip it completely if the user wants no animation
m_movingWindowsSet.clear();
QHash<EffectWindow*, WindowMotion>::iterator it = m_managedWindows.begin();
for (; it != m_managedWindows.end(); it++) {
WindowMotion *motion = &it.value();
motion->translation.finish();
motion->scale.finish();
}
}
QHash<EffectWindow*, WindowMotion>::iterator it = m_managedWindows.begin();
for (; it != m_managedWindows.end(); it++) {
WindowMotion *motion = &it.value();
bool stopped = false;
// TODO: What happens when distance() == 0 but we are still moving fast?
// TODO: Motion needs to be calculated from the window's center
QPointF diffT = motion->translation.distance();
if (diffT != QPoint(0.0, 0.0)) {
// Still moving
motion->translation.calculate(time);
diffT = motion->translation.distance();
if (qAbs(diffT.x()) < 0.5 && qAbs(motion->translation.velocity().x()) < 0.2 &&
qAbs(diffT.y()) < 0.5 && qAbs(motion->translation.velocity().y()) < 0.2) {
// Hide tiny oscillations
motion->translation.finish();
diffT = QPoint(0.0, 0.0);
stopped = true;
}
}
QPointF diffS = motion->scale.distance();
if (diffS != QPoint(0.0, 0.0)) {
// Still scaling
motion->scale.calculate(time);
diffS = motion->scale.distance();
if (qAbs(diffS.x()) < 0.001 && qAbs(motion->scale.velocity().x()) < 0.05 &&
qAbs(diffS.y()) < 0.001 && qAbs(motion->scale.velocity().y()) < 0.05) {
// Hide tiny oscillations
motion->scale.finish();
diffS = QPoint(0.0, 0.0);
stopped = true;
}
}
// We just finished this window's motion
if (stopped && diffT == QPoint(0.0, 0.0) && diffS == QPoint(0.0, 0.0))
m_movingWindowsSet.remove(it.key());
}
}
